The Government of Punjab, on January 31, 2026, issued the Punjab Management and Transfer of Municipal Properties (Amendment) Rules, 2026, to further amend the Punjab Management and Transfer of Municipal Properties Rules, 2021.
The following amendment has been stated namely: -
• In rule 3, sub-rule (1), after clause (b), the following clause shall be inserted, namely:- “ (ba) “ Chunk Sites” means the sites or properties with successful bid price or allotment price of twenty crore rupees or above;'."
• In rule 16, for sub-rule (1), the following shall be substituted, namely :- “ (1) The sale price for properties, other than Chunk Sites, shall be payable in the following manner, namely:-
(i) Twenty-five percent of the sale price of such property (after adjusting the amount of five percent of reserve price paid as earnest money) shall be payable within a period of forty-five days from the date of allotment. If the said amount is not paid within the total period of forty-five days from the date of allotment, the allotment shall be deemed to have been cancelled and the amount already deposited shall stand forfeited; and
(ii) The remaining amount of seventy-five percent shall be payable in three equal installments payable every forty-five days with simple interest at the rate of nine and a half percent per annum. The interest shall be payable after forty-five days from the date of allotment:
Provided that if any installment which is payable under this clause is not deposited within the stipulated time period, then, the same may be deposited with the subsequent installment or upto the date on which the last installment is payable subject to the payment of three percent as penalty on the said amount:
Provided further that if the entire sale price is not paid within the time period as stipulated in this clause, the allotment shall be deemed to have been cancelled and twenty-five percent of the sale price shall be forfeited:
Provided further that if the allottee makes lump sum payment of remaining amount of seventy-five percent within forty-five days from the date of allotment, then, in that case, five percent rebate on the balance principal amount (i.e. seventy-five percent) shall be given.
